TPEEPreparation of nylon 66 salt
Nylon 66 salt are prepared respectively the temperature ethanol ethanol solution with adipic acid hexanediamine at 60 DEG C above the mixing and salt precipitation, filtering, alcohol washing, drying, and finally preparing aqueous solution of 63%, use for polycondensation. The reaction formula is as follows:
polycondensation
The polycondensation of nylon 66 salt should be carried out at high temperature, with the removal of water, resulting in the formation of linear high molecular weight nylon 66. The reaction formula is as follows:
The production process is divided into two kinds: intermittent method and continuous method. Continuous method is suitable for large-scale production, and the production of nylon 66 in the world mainly adopts continuous method. The batch method is used only in two cases: one is to produce special?or?experimental grade; two is in a small device with a production capacity of 4 500t A.。
